Created attachment 183155 [details] LastCrash SUMMARY I just wanted to change the Advanced Color picker to LAB Mode. STEPS TO REPRODUCE Start Krita (Windows, Steam version 5.2.10). Open Settings → Configure Advanced Color Selector Settings. Enable Custom LAB color space (e.g. L*A*B). Confirm the selection—Krita shows the selector briefly, then crashes hard. After that, Krita will not start again unless the config is reset. OBSERVED RESULT After confirming the custom LAB setting, Krita crashes after some secounds. On restart, Krita doesn’t open at all—a splash, but no window. Deleting the Part [advancedColorSelector] in kritarc, reset the configuration for the colorpicker. And Krita starts normal again. EXPECTED RESULT The Advanced Color Selector should apply the chosen LAB config without issues. Enabling/disabling custom LAB should work safely via the UI. SOFTWARE/OS VERSIONS Windows: Windows 10, (Steam Krita 5.2.10) ADDITIONAL INFORMATION Product: Krita Version: 5.2.10 (Windows, Steam) Component: Color Selectors (Advanced Color Selector) Platform: Microsoft Windows 10 Steam installation. Reproducibility: Probably reproducible, im not touching that setting again. attachment of last Crashlog (of a starting attempt)
